摘要
In the past few decades, in vitro selection based on tissue culture techniques has developed as a useful tool for improving biotic as well as abiotic stress tolerance in crops. Rice is a staple crop and is susceptible to drought and salt stress. Tolerance can be acquired in vitro by using selection agents such as polyethylene glycol, mannitol, salicylic acid, sorbitol, sucrose for drought tolerance and sodium chloride (NaCl) for salt stress tolerance. There have been several reports of successful in vitro screening for stress tolerance such as drought and salt in different rice cultivars. In vitro screening helps in earlier determination of stress tolerance/ susceptibility under control condition unlike field screening, however validation needs field screening. This paper reviews the work done on in vitro screening of rice for salt and drought stress tolerance. In Indian scenario, drought and salinity is a challenge for rice crop production and the use of in vitro selection may aid in development of new cultivars of rice under stressed conditions.
